Lt. Brad Hall says he was questioning Flesher when he heard the 4-wheeler start up and go toward another deputy. Deputies say that 4-wheeler turned out to be stolen and painted black to disguise it. Flesher quickly made bond but didn't show up for court and has been on the run ever since.
Authorities thought they had caught up with Flesher a few weeks ago. They chased him into a wooded area in DeKalb County. At that time he wasn't on 4-wheeler but a motorcycle, which he drove to the edge of the woods, jumped off and made his get-a-way on foot.
In addition to Tennessee, the TBI says Flesher has been arrested in Georgia in the past 12 months, and could be moving between the two states.
Flesher has three distinctive tattoos, one on each shoulder and the name Melissa across his stomach. He was born in 1970. He has brown hair, hazel eyes, is about 6'1" and weighs 205 pounds. If you've seen him, call 1-800-TBI-FIND.
